Blackman Hosts Not-for-Profit Client Workshop

On Tuesday, May 25, Blackman Kallick hosted the first in a series of Not-for-Profit Client Breakfast Workshops designed to provide in-depth, hands-on assistance with pressing accounting issues facing not-for-profit organizations. Topics covered were:

  • Fair Value Measurements and Disclosures for Entities that Calculate Net Asset Value per Share
  • Provide guidance on the net asset classification of donor-restricted endowment funds under GAAP

Clients were also given the opportunity to share their organizations' financial statements and work through questions in an educational, confidential environment. Below are a few pictures from the event.
